    Why does it seem all crappie rods I have seen have such small eyelets on the rods? Where I fish in the spring we get this popple fuzz they comes off the trees and floats on the water like tiny little balls of cotton, gets caught up on the fishing line and always jams up on those small eyelets on the rod so you can't cast out worth a darn. Why don't they make crappie rods with the bigger type eyelets?
